Автор: Марк Кан
Форма обучения:
дистанционная
Стоимость самостоятельного обучения:
бесплатно
Доступ:
свободный
Документ об окончании:
 
Уровень:
Для всех
Длительность:
9:20:00
Студентов:
8897
Выпускников:
1678
Качество курса:
4.14 | 3.85
Курс посвящен изучению языка программирования JavaScript.
JavaScript является языком сценариев (скриптов), который применяют в основном для создания на Web-страницах интерактивных элементов. Его можно использовать для построения меню, проверки правильности заполнения форм, смены изображений или для чего-то еще, что можно сделать на Web-странице.
 

План занятий

Занятие
Заголовок <<
Дата изучения
Лекция 1
16 минут
Язык сценариев JavaScript
Введение в язык сценариев JavaScript.
-
Лекция 2
20 минут
Операторы и функции
Основы проверки сценариев. Операторы if и else. Способы записи комментариев. Краткое знакомство с функциями.
-
Тест 2
24 минуты
-
Лекция 3
23 минуты
Формы и циклы
Основы работы с полями форм и с функциями циклов.
-
Лекция 4
19 минут
Функции и концепция объектов
В этой лекции будут полностью рассмотрены функции и представлена концепция объектов в JavaScript.
-
Тест 4
24 минуты
-
Лекция 5
26 минут
Строки, числа и массивы
Внутренняя работа присущих JavaScript объектов: строк, чисел и массивов.
-
Тест 5
24 минуты
-
Лекция 6
25 минут
Объектная модель документа
Объектная модель документа или коротко DOM (Document Object Model). Функции document.forms, document.getElementById, document.createElement и некоторые другие, которые встроены в объект document.
-
Лекция 7
27 минут
Объект документа и объект окна
Объект документа (document) и объект окна (window). Функции setTimeout и setInterval, window.opener, document.body и document.documentElement. Cвойства документа title, referer и cookies.
-
Тест 7
24 минуты
-
Лекция 8
20 минут
Основы объектно-ориентированного программирования
Основы объектно-ориентированного программирования (ООП) в JavaScript. new Object и объектные литералы. Прототипирование. Переменные Private, Public и Static.
-
Лекция 9
14 минут
Наследование и замыкание
Метод наследования. Полезные (и опасные) свойства замыкания.
-
Лекция 10
25 минут
Основы приложений AJAX
Основы приложений AJAX. Создание объекта XMLHttp. Варианты получения данных: XML, JSON или обычный текст. Пример со списком контактов.
-
Лекция 11
21 минута
Обработка ошибок в JavaScript
Обработка ошибок в JavaScript: Синтаксические ошибки. Ошибки времени выполнения. Window.onerror. Try/Catch/Finally и Throw. Обработка ошибок в AJAX
-
Лекция 12
15 минут
Рекурсия
Рекурсия. Стек. Создание собственного стека. Применение рекурсии.
-
Краткое руководство по AJAX

Оглавление
-
Учебное руководство по XHTML

Оглавление
-
1 час 40 минут
-
Владислав Нагорный
Владислав Нагорный

Подскажите, пожалуйста, планируете ли вы возобновление программ высшего образования? Если да, есть ли какие-то примерные сроки?

Спасибо!

Лариса Парфенова
Лариса Парфенова

1) Можно ли экстерном получить второе высшее образование "Программная инженерия" ?

2) Трудоустраиваете ли Вы выпускников?

3) Можно ли с Вашим дипломом поступить в аспирантуру?

 

Владислав Железняк
Владислав Железняк
Украина
Vanlun Kristian
Vanlun Kristian
Россия